On our BSc Business and Management, you will learn about key principles including innovation, entrepreneurship and sustainability that underpin business and management across the globe. You will learn from experts in their field, work with leading business practitioners, and benefit from world-leading research.

Entry Requirements
UCAS Tariff
Not Accepted
Scottish Higher
A,A,A,B,B
Must be combined with Scottish Advanced Highers. See below for GCSE and English requirements.
Access to HE Diploma
D:36,M:9
in any subject. See below for GCSE and English requirements.
International Baccalaureate Diploma Programme
34
See below for GCSE and English requirements. We will also accept 3 x Higher Level Certificates at 666
Pearson BTEC Level 3 National Extended Diploma (first teaching from September 2016)
D*DD
In any subject. See below for GCSE and English requirements.
Pearson BTEC Level 3 National Diploma (first teaching from September 2016)
D*D
in any subject combined with a GCE A Level. See below for GCSE and English requirements.
Scottish Advanced Higher
A,A
Must be combined with Scottish Highers. See below for GCSE and English requirements.
Cambridge International Pre-U Certificate - Principal
D3,M1,M1
See below for GCSE and English requirements.
Extended Project
Not Accepted
Pearson BTEC Level 3 National Extended Certificate (first teaching from September 2016)
D
in any subject combined with two GCE A Levels. See below for GCSE and English requirements.
A level
A,A,A
See below for GCSE and English requirements.
WJEC Level 3 Advanced Skills Baccalaureate Wales
A
Only accepted alongside A-Level grades BB GCSE requirements - English Maths Grade C/4
